diff --git a/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/controller/FlinkController.java b/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/controller/FlinkController.java index 143feec..c02b1cb 100644 --- a/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/controller/FlinkController.java +++ b/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/controller/FlinkController.java @@ -63,7 +63,7 @@ public class FlinkController { } @GetMapping("/checkpoint") - public FlinkCheckpoint checkpoint(@RequestParam("url") String url, @RequestParam("vertex_id") String vertexId, @RequestParam("checkpoint_id") String checkpointId) throws JsonProcessingException { + public FlinkCheckpoint checkpoint(@RequestParam("url") String url, @RequestParam("vertex_id") String vertexId, @RequestParam("checkpoint_id") Long checkpointId) throws JsonProcessingException { return flinkService.checkpoint(url, vertexId, checkpointId); } diff --git a/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/service/FlinkService.java b/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/service/FlinkService.java index 88dfedf..e9c0fb0 100644 --- a/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/service/FlinkService.java +++ b/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/service/FlinkService.java @@ -25,7 +25,7 @@ public interface FlinkService { FlinkCheckpointOverview checkpointOverview(String url, String vertexId) throws JsonProcessingException; - FlinkCheckpoint checkpoint(String url, String vertexId, String checkpointId) throws JsonProcessingException; + FlinkCheckpoint checkpoint(String url, String vertexId, Long checkpointId) throws JsonProcessingException; FlinkCheckpointConfig checkpointConfig(String url, String vertexId) throws JsonProcessingException; diff --git a/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/service/impl/FlinkServiceImpl.java b/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/service/impl/FlinkServiceImpl.java index 9273e1c..88f51c4 100644 --- a/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/service/impl/FlinkServiceImpl.java +++ b/service-flink-query/src/main/java/com/lanyuanxiaoyao/service/flink/service/impl/FlinkServiceImpl.java @@ -98,7 +98,7 @@ public class FlinkServiceImpl implements FlinkService { @Cacheable(value = "flink-checkpoint", sync = true) @Retryable(Throwable.class) @Override - public FlinkCheckpoint checkpoint(String url, String vertexId, String checkpointId) throws JsonProcessingException { + public FlinkCheckpoint checkpoint(String url, String vertexId, Long checkpointId) throws JsonProcessingException { return mapper.readValue(get(url, StrUtil.format("/v1/jobs/{}/checkpoints/details/{}", vertexId, checkpointId)), FlinkCheckpoint.class); } diff --git a/service-forest/src/main/java/com/lanyuanxiaoyao/service/forest/service/FlinkService.java b/service-forest/src/main/java/com/lanyuanxiaoyao/service/forest/service/FlinkService.java index 4c1ea91..77afd4d 100644 --- a/service-forest/src/main/java/com/lanyuanxiaoyao/service/forest/service/FlinkService.java +++ b/service-forest/src/main/java/com/lanyuanxiaoyao/service/forest/service/FlinkService.java @@ -37,7 +37,7 @@ public interface FlinkService { FlinkCheckpointOverview checkpointOverview(@Query("url") String url, @Query("vertex_id") String vertexId); @Get("/flink/checkpoint") - FlinkCheckpoint checkpoint(@Query("url") String url, @Query("vertex_id") String vertexId, @Query("checkpoint_id") String checkpointId); + FlinkCheckpoint checkpoint(@Query("url") String url, @Query("vertex_id") String vertexId, @Query("checkpoint_id") Long checkpointId); @Get("/flink/checkpoint_config") FlinkCheckpointConfig checkpointConfig(@Query("url") String url, @Query("vertex_id") String vertexId);